N. SATHISH KUMAR, J.
Aggrieved over the dismissal of the suit filed for specific performance enforcing the contract, dated 29.11.2007 the present appeal came to be filed by the plaintiff. The parties are arrayed as per their own ranking before the Trial Court for the sake of convenience.
2. The brief facts of the plaintiff case is as follows :-
The defendants 1 to 3 being the owner of the 1st item of the suit property agreed to sell the suit property to the plaintiff at the rate of Rs.99,230/- per acre and executed an agreement of sale, dated 29.11.2007 and received Rs.40,00,000/- as advance. It is also agreed that part of the remaining sale consideration shall be paid on 23.05.2008 and sale shall be completed before 25.05.2008. It is also stipulated in the agreement that the defendants should make marketable title by demarcating and identifying the property and also to evict the encroachers. On the date of agreement, the defendants 1 to 3 have handed over the title deeds relating to the suit properties to the plaintiff. In pursuant to the agreement, the defendants also sold an extent of 17 acres and 60 cents to the plaintiff's sister-in-law on the direction of the plaintiff
